Website Details Alexa
Ranking
Semrush
Ranking
MOZ
Ranking
Ahref
Ranking
SimilarWeb
Ranking
Quantcast
Ranking
Title: -
Interests: inspiration, images, web apps, slides, community
Keywords: free powerpoint templates, powerpoint templates, powerpoint backgrounds
6'180 4.9 35'599 29'328
Title: -
Interests: design, mac, internet, sign, technology
Keywords: camtasia, snagit, camtasia studio
5'448 5.7 27'022 7'483